Hi all ,

my pc has only 2 com port ( rs232 ) , is it possible to convert it to 16 ports ?
i have heard something as NPORT , what is this ?
does this device do that ? and if do how would windows know it ?
for example if i use NPORT and install it's driver , then i will see 16 COM ports in hyperterminal ?

Thanks ,
& Best regards.
 

If you have unpopulated PCI slot you should consider multiport cards such as for example from RocketPort: https://www.comtrol.com/products/rocketport.asp
In this instance you will "see" all COMs in Hyperterminal, and other Windows-based applications, as COM1, .., COM15 ..
